1. Pressure or Power Washer 

First up on our list and one of the best electric yard tools is a pressure or power washer. Pressure washers make cleaning grime off things so much quicker and easier. They reduce task times from hours to minutes!

As its name suggests, a power washer is a high-pressure water sprayer. These electric garden tools can be used to remove dirt, mud, debris, mold, and loose paint from surfaces. They can be used on a number of different things, including:

  • Cars
  • Walls or siding
  • Fencing
  • Driveways
  • Garage doors
  • Outdoor or patio furniture 
  • Outdoor grills

2. String Trimmer

A huge time-saving landscaping power tool that is great to have on hand is a string trimmer. String trimmers not only keep your garden and lawn edges neat and tidy, but they also make keeping your lawn pristine an absolute breeze!

These landscaping power tools make weeding a walk in the park. They are also perfect for trimming grass and weeds along uneven or irregular terrain. As this tool uses a fast-spinning plastic line instead of a blade to cut, they are great to use near objects such as trees or steps. 

This tool is a must-have for those who like to keep their edging along their pathways, driveways, and even patios looking pristine.

3. Rototiller

For those who are forever digging up an area to make a new garden bed, a rototiller is the tool for you. This outdoor power tool greatly reduces the amount of time it would typically take to dig up and hoe a new garden bed. This practical little machine has blades that rotate powerfully, ideal for loosening soil and preparing it for planting. Rototillers also come in handy during the growing season as they can be used to aerate the soil before planting. 

4. Hedge Trimmer

Trimming your hedges with handheld shears can become a time-consuming and tedious task. With a cordless hedge trimmer, the task becomes quick, simple, and pain-free. Resembling a chainsaw, this tool has been designed specifically to trim back the leggy growth of bushes, hedges, and shrubs. 

Hedge trimmers not only reduce the time it takes to do the job, but also provide a clean and neat finish. A bonus to these garden power tools is that they also give you some added length and extend your reach for those hard-to-reach places. 

5. Pole Saws

Like a hedge trimmer, pole saws are designed to extend your reach so that you can trim tree branches without using a ladder. Essentially, this electric garden tool is a pole with a chainsaw attached to the end of it. Pole saw stops you from having to climb up and down a ladder to trim untidy, overhanging branches. 

6. Shredders or Chippers

Shredders or chippers are excellent for turning yard waste into wood chips and mulch. With these outdoor power tools, you can easily turn your excess yard waste into usable ground cover for your trees. Rather than spending all that extra time and energy bagging and dragging dropped leaves, limbs, and brush to the curb, let a chipper or shredder do the dirty work for you. 7. Lawn Vacuum 

Another tedious task on the list of garden chores is raking fallen leaves. This job is far better done with the use of a lawn vacuum. This handy tool can be pushed around your lawn to pick up all the loose leaves, and its typically strong enough to pick up leaves AND other organic material, too.

8. Leaf Shredder 

Just like the shredder or chipper, a leaf shredder is very useful in turning garden waste into mulch or compost. Whether you have heaps of leaves or just a bunch every now and then, shredding and reusing them is a great way to reduce your garden waste and return nutrients to your soil naturally. This garden power tool is perfect for use in conjunction with a lawn vacuum or leaf blower.
